Application Information
The BP2831A is a high performance non-isolated
Buck converter specially designed for LED lighting.
The device integrates a 500V power MOSFET. With
very few external components, the converter
achieves excellent constant current control. And it
does not need auxiliary winding for powering the IC
or voltage sensing, hence the system size and cost is
greatly reduced.
Start Up
After system powered up, the VCC pin capacitor is
charged up by the start up resistor. When the VCC
pin voltage reaches the turn on threshold, the internal
circuits start operating. The BP2831A integrates a
17V zener diode to clamp the VCC voltage. Due to
the ultra-low operating current, the auxiliary winding
is not needed to supply the IC.
Constant Current Control
Cycle by Cycle current sense is adopted in BP2831A,
the CS pin is connected to the current sense
comparator, and the voltage on CS pin is compared
with the internal 400mV reference voltage. The
MOSFET will be switched off when the voltage on
CS pin reaches the threshold. The CS comparator
includes a 350ns leading edge blanking time.
